Context

Resonance Labs needed to improve an AI-driven demo for enterprise document retrieval. I led UX/UI design, resolving navigation and user role issues. Through design system development and user flow refinements, navigation efficiency increased by 25%. Collaborating with PMs, engineers, and data scientists, the project ran for five months.

Quick facts

Quick facts

  • Backstory: Resonance Labs developed a virtual assistant to support enterprise knowledge retrieval but faced usability issues during client demos.

  • The Problem: Users were overwhelmed by poor navigation, unclear user roles, and irrelevant data handling.

  • What I Did: Conducted a UX audit, redesigned core user flows, and implemented a role-based onboarding structure.

  • Why: To improve user efficiency, secure new clients, and align the demo experience with business objectives.

  • Impact: Achieved a 25% increase in navigation efficiency and a 55% boost in workflow satisfaction.

UX Process Snapshot

Research and analysis

I conducted a multi-method research strategy to identify design bottlenecks, usability issues, and areas for improvement in the ad-hoc demo.
Research revealed key frustrations like poor navigation flow, lack of tailored user roles, and insufficient data access and permissions control.

User Preferences

Based on the research findings, the user preferences gathered included:

  1. Control over privacy settings

  2. Reduced over-saturation of options and features

  3. Enhanced avatar controls

  4. Ability to add members more easily

  5. Greater control over system features

  6. Clearer insights on costs and constraints

Additionally, survey feedback showed:

  • 50% were only somewhat satisfied with the demo presentation.

Key Takeaways

šŸ”„ Iterative Design Evolution
The project highlighted the importance of refining designs through iterative feedback loops. Limited user insights hindered early prototypes, but usability improvements based on demo data significantly improved navigation and feature accessibility.

šŸŽÆ Tailored Solutions Drive Business Success
Customising solutions for client-specific needs (e.g., the aerospace FIVA use case) led to measurable business impacts. Industry-tailored demos increased adoption rates and workflow efficiencies across multiple sectors.

šŸ¤ Collaboration for Scalability
Working within a small cross-functional team reinforced the importance of design scalability. Developing a shared design system reduced rework time by 30 hours per sprint and improved delivery times by 15%, enhancing team coordination and output consistency.

This experience deepened my understanding of balancing stakeholder needs with scalable UX solutions, a skill I’m eager to leverage for future projects.
